Senior Manager QMS

Essential Duties and Responsibilities

  • Reports to the Global Director QMS
  • Manages the Corporate QMS Team
  • Oversees the management of the COE audit program, including auditor resources
  • Develops, trains and mentors other personnel on auditing practices, quality methods, and other related quality tools
  • Maintains COE QMS and related documentation
  • Drives problem solving through effective root cause identification and corrective action
  • Collaborates and calibrates with other COE QMS managers as part of the global QMS
  • Drives QMS initiatives and strategies, processes, policies, communication, and guidelines to comply with quality standards and regulations (as defined by EnerSys leadership strategic direction and context of the organization).
  • Oversees the maintenance of required quality certifications across multiple locations
  • Oversees company processes focusing on customer requirements, needs, and expectations—both internal and external.
  • Engages with COE leadership and management teams to propose and implement QMS initiatives, quality objectives and KPIs while providing robust risk assessment data to aid in decision making.
  • Innovates by deploying a quality management culture throughout the organization, supporting COE quality sites and different lines of business, and ensuring compliance with industry standards and readiness for quality system audits.
  • Promotes a process approach mindset and global standardization of processes, best practices and methods.
  • Promotes the continual improvement quality culture and drives internal projects to achieve simplified and effective results.
  • Coordinates audit teams to perform quality audits to ensure standard and procedural compliance and to continually improve quality performance.
  • Mentors and develops auditors to improve competence and ensure continuing professional development
  • Serves as the liaison for a global (QMS).
  • Travel 25%

Qualifications

  • BS degree (or equivalent) in related disciplines. Master’s degree a plus
  • Minimum 10+ years of Quality Management Systems experience
  • Extensive knowledge of Quality tools (i.e. FMEA, APQP, PPAP, MSA, SPC, VDA 6.3, etc)
  • Experience in direct management and development of people and teams.
  • Proven experience leading regional or multi-site QMS strategy and transformation initiatives
  • Experience managing certification schemes (i.e. ISO 9001, IATF 16949, AS9100)
  • Lead auditor trained and/or certified in ISO 9001, IATF 16949, and/or other applicable international standards
  • Other relevant QMS standards a plus (ISO 13485, ISO 19443, NQA-1, etc.)
  • Demonstrated success influencing senior leadership and driving cross-functional alignment
  • Experience managing teams across multiple locations and leading through indirect influence
  • Experience with budget planning, resource allocation, and prioritization of quality initiatives
  • Strong executive communication skills, including presentation of KPIs, risks, and strategic recommendations
  • Demonstrated change management and organizational development experience
  • Experience leading management review, governance processes, and enterprise-level corrective action escalation
  • Experience working with AI to improve business system efficiency
  • Experience in project management and successfully delivering results
  • Preferred experience in regulated industries and customer/regulatory audit interface
